Compare all specifications:
1963 Abarth 595 | 1972 Toyota Publica | |
Make | Abarth | Toyota |
Model | 595 | Publica |
Year Released | 1963 | 1972 |
Engine Position | Rear | Front |
Engine Size | 594 cc | 993 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 2 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 27 HP | 47 HP |
Engine RPM | 5000 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que RPM | 3500 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 470 kg | 684 kg |
Vehicle Length | 2980 mm | 3700 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1330 mm | 1460 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1330 mm | 1390 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 1850 mm | 2170 mm |
